Web24 aug. 2024 · Although shellac is a popular natural resin, it cannot be considered vegan since it is directly obtained from an animal source – the lac insects. The production of shellac is directly tied with the death of thousands of these insects. It is estimated that a kilogram of shellac can mean the death of around up to 300 thousand lac insects ( 2 ). WebUsing Shellac Shellac has an intriguing history and interesting origins that could be the subject of a whole article in itself. It is a resin that is secreted by the lac beetle onto the small branches of trees found in parts of Thailand and India. The resin is harvested by breaking the twigs and removing the resin with rollers. Lac is the name given to the resinous secretion of the tiny lac insect (Laccifer lacca) which is parasitic on certain trees in Asia, particularly India and Thailand. Web24 nov. 2024 · Shellac (/ʃəˈlæk/) is a resin secreted by the female lac bug on trees in the forests of India and Thailand. (The word lac means "one hundred thousand," referring to the number of insects found on a single branch. Approximately 1.5 million bugs must be harvested to make 1 pound of shellac.)
